ABU DHABI, 23rd May, 2016 (WAM) -- The Central Bank of the UAE announced today that Abdulrahim Mohammed Al Awadhi, Executive Director of Anti-Money Laundering and Suspicious Cases Unit, AMLSCU, of the UAE, and Talal Ali Al Sayegh, President of the Kuwait Financial Intelligence Unit and Chairman of National Committee of Combating Money Laundering and Financing of Terrorism, signed a Memorandum of Understanding, MoU, on Sunday, following a meeting at the Head office of the Central Bank of the UAE in Abu Dhabi to discuss matters of mutual interest.

The MoU covers mutual cooperation in different areas that are of interest to both parties regarding financial information related to money laundering and the financing of terrorism in order to support, enhance and strengthen policies of combating the issue.

With the signing of this MoU, the total number of MoUs signed by AMLSCU has reached 52; 43 with its strategic international and regional counterparts and 9 with domestic strategic partners.

This demonstrates the UAEs commitment to continuing cooperation with the international community, and with international, regional, and domestic strategic partners to coordinate the efforts on countering money laundering, financing of terrorism and related crimes.
